基础概念
MySQL启动超时是指MySQL服务器在启动过程中花费的时间超过了预设的超时时间,导致无法正常启动。这可能是由于多种原因引起的,例如配置错误、资源不足、文件权限问题等。
相关优势
- 稳定性:确保MySQL服务器能够稳定启动,避免因启动超时导致的系统不可用。
- 性能:优化启动过程,减少启动时间,提高系统整体性能。
类型
MySQL启动超时可以分为以下几种类型:
- 配置错误:如
my.cnf
文件中的配置不正确。 - 资源不足:如内存不足、磁盘空间不足等。
- 文件权限问题:如MySQL数据目录和日志文件的权限设置不正确。
- 网络问题:如网络配置错误或网络连接问题。
- 其他问题:如操作系统问题、硬件故障等。
应用场景
MySQL启动超时的应用场景包括但不限于:
- 生产环境:确保MySQL服务器能够快速稳定地启动,避免影响业务运行。
- 开发环境:在开发和测试过程中,快速定位和解决启动超时问题。
常见原因及解决方法
- 配置错误
- 原因:
my.cnf
文件中的配置不正确,如端口号、数据目录等。 - 解决方法:检查
my.cnf
文件中的配置,确保所有配置项正确无误。 - 解决方法:检查
my.cnf
文件中的配置,确保所有配置项正确无误。
- 资源不足
- 原因:内存不足、磁盘空间不足等。
- 解决方法:检查系统资源使用情况,增加内存或磁盘空间。
- 解决方法:检查系统资源使用情况,增加内存或磁盘空间。
- 文件权限问题
- 原因:MySQL数据目录和日志文件的权限设置不正确。
- 解决方法:确保MySQL数据目录和日志文件的权限设置正确。
- 解决方法:确保MySQL数据目录和日志文件的权限设置正确。
- 网络问题
- 原因:网络配置错误或网络连接问题。
- 解决方法:检查网络配置,确保网络连接正常。
- 解决方法:检查网络配置,确保网络连接正常。
- 其他问题
- 原因:操作系统问题、硬件故障等。
- 解决方法:检查操作系统日志和硬件状态,排除故障。
- 解决方法:检查操作系统日志和硬件状态,排除故障。
参考链接
通过以上方法,您可以逐步排查和解决MySQL启动超时的问题。如果问题依然存在,建议查看MySQL的错误日志,获取更多详细的错误信息,以便进一步分析和解决。